Rosberg under investigation for Hamilton crash
Nico Rosberg is under investigation for his last-lap crash with teammate Lewis Hamilton in the Austrian Grand Prix. The German and the Briton made contact when Hamilton tried to pass Rosberg for the lead at Turn 2, the championship leader running wide and ending up damaging his own car after hitting the other Mercedes. Rosberg had to crawl back to the pits with part of his front wing under his car to finish in fourth place. Hamilton went on to win the race. Race direction announced Rosberg is now under investigation for causing a collision and failing to stop with a seriously damaged car.
